Description
This presentation highlights key national and state research findings describing long-term supports and services (LTSS) for adults and children with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ities. Variations in state policies and use of Medicaid funding authorities are reflected in the types of places people with IDD live, average expenditures, and the extent to which LTSS are provided to support people living in family homes, their own home, or other community settings.Back to Session: Welcome Reception and Evening Poster Session
